• The MWCNTS-fluorine-co-doped TiO2 was synthesized by solid state method.
• This MWCNTS-fluorine-co-doped TiO2 exhibited higher UV light absorption.
• The MWCNTS-fluorine shows higher antimicrobial activity.
• Moreover, the MWCNTS-fluorine exhibits excellent photocatalytic stability.
Multi-walled carbon nanotubes-fluorine-co-doped TiO2 composite was synthesized by the solid state method. The prepared photocatalysts were characterized by using XRD, FTIR and FE-SEM. In addition, the samples were evaluated for antimicrobial activity and photocatalytic activity. The composites exhibited enhanced absorption properties in the UV light range compared to pure TiO2. The MWCNTS-F-co-doped TiO2 composites showed significant photocatalytic activity in the generation of oxygen.
